On Mon, Nov 15, 2004 at 10:47:16AM +1100, Donovan Baarda wrote:
>I don't understand why the execute bits would not be set.
Remote shares are assumed to be non-executable by default for speed
considerations.
You can fix this by mounting the share with the -x option:
mount -x -f //foo/bar /bar
Mounting the share in that manner will cause cygwin (and setup
postinstall scripts) to consider everything in /bar to be consdired
executable. It might be better to mount any specific directories that
you know will contain executable content with -x:
mount -x -f //foo/c/cygwin/bin /bin
mount -x -f //foo/c/cygwin/sbin /sbin
mount -x -f //foo/c/cygwin/usr/sbin /usr/sbin
etc.
